Bronx Museum of Arts, Bronx, USA New York, North America
The Bronx Museum of Arts is an art museum located in the South Bronx borough of New York City, USA.
It focuses on contemporary and 20th-century art, with a particular emphasis on works by artists of African, Asian, and Latin American descent.

Facts & Legends
The museum's location on the Grand Concourse places it within a historically significant cultural corridor of the Bronx, known for its Art Deco architecture.
